Provincial rules for Whitchurch-Stouffville borrowers

Ontario licenses the lender rather than the loan, and that is the position for a Whitchurch-Stouffville borrower as well.

The payday position recorded for Ontario is part of the same framework, and it applies in Whitchurch-Stouffville as it does across the province: A licensed payday regime operates here. the federal Payday Lending Regulations (SOR/2024-114) cap the total cost of borrowing at $14 per $100 advanced, and a province may set a lower figure, and the lower figure applies. Confirm the cap currently in force with the provincial regulator.

What decides an outcome for Whitchurch-Stouffville

What a lender in Whitchurch-Stouffville does with a renovation loan file: the lender reads the scope of the work, the equity available and the credit file.

For Whitchurch-Stouffville, the file is built from identification, income proof, banking records and a statement of obligations.

Nothing in the Whitchurch-Stouffville assessment turns on the address itself; the file, the income and the obligations carry the decision.
